Fallen Tree Removal in Reno, NV
Fallen tree removal services involve safely cutting and removing trees that have toppled, become hazardous, or are otherwise obstructing a property. This type of work typically covers situations such as storm-damaged trees, dead or decaying trees, or trees that pose a risk to structures, power lines, or landscaping. Property owners considering this service should understand the importance of assessing the size, location, and condition of the tree, as well as any potential obstacles around it, to ensure proper and safe removal.
Before requesting fallen tree removal, homeowners often want to know about the scope of the work involved, including whether the debris will be fully cleared and how the process might impact the surrounding landscape. It is also helpful to consider any access restrictions or safety precautions that might be necessary during the removal process.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the project proceeds smoothly and safely.

Fallen Tree Removal Questions
When is fallen tree removal necessary? Removal is needed when a tree is hazardous, blocking access, or causing property damage.
What are common signs of a tree in decline? Signs include dead branches, leaning, cracks in the trunk, or root exposure.
How does fallen tree removal impact landscaping? It clears space and prevents further damage, helping maintain the property's appearance and safety.
What should property owners consider before removal? Consider nearby structures, utility lines, and the overall health of surrounding trees.
